Transaction 59d7fc1e234271ddf5cdadea835c33dd78d25510a0caccac3de4940c186aaf92
1 Input
1 Output
-
59d7fc1e234271ddf5cdadea835c33dd78d25510a0caccac3de4940c186aaf92:0
- value
- 121040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45e148bf40252a7d65e90c380ae778ea17f3b312 OP_EQUAL
- address
- 384WRoGLSqJLPNPJDeGFVFW1Pk9ADikLr6